To succeed in business communication, we can look to AI’s potential to maximize productivity and increase efficiency in any organization. While AI is a valuable asset, it is crucial to adhere to certain ethical principles when using AI; it’s also important to keep up with its capacities as it becomes more and more sophisticated. Those who can continually adapt to AI’s growing functionality will thrive in the Age of AI.
In this course on Strategies for Balancing AI and Human Communication, we will go over the best practices for evaluating business communication needs and adapting to the use of AI to fulfill these demands. We will explore AI’s many applications for business communication and consider the ways humans can use AI most effectively to reach communication objectives. Finally, we will consider how to use AI ethically, as well as how to ensure that your business adapts with AI as it evolves.
